 | Sheep Shed | | by B Nelson | | published on Jun 30, 2009 | Actually a shedding sheep! Patsy is the combination of a Jacob wool sheep crossed with a Barbado hair sheep. She is black, brown, and white, and at one year of age, she is shedding, and looks pretty messy. The advantage of hair sheep is that they do not need shearing, which is a lot of work. Patsy has five horns. |
